June is National PTSD Awareness Month. Join Voices Center for Resilience on June 11th at 7:00 pm for “A Pathway to Healing: Recovering from PTSD,” an informative webinar about healing from stress and trauma. Those exposed to traumatic events are often at risk of developing symptoms of Post Traumatic Stress (PTSD). Nick deSpoelberch, LPC, from the Fairfield County Trauma Response Team (FCTRT) will provide a comprehensive overview of the impact of trauma, including the symptoms of PTSD, the benefits of EMDR therapy and opportunities for post-traumatic growth. FCTRT is a non-profit alliance of mental health professionals dedicated to helping First Responders and the CT Community heal from trauma, tragedy and stress.

The presentation will include practical techniques and resources that support recovery and resilience. Nick will be joined by a first responder who will share a powerful testimony about the journey through PTSD and finding healing.

Attendees will be able to:

• Identify the signs of PTSD

• Recognize the science of trauma’s action on the brain and the body

• Understand the benefits of EMDR treatment

• Identify techniques, resources, and a pathway towards post traumatic growth

About Voices Center for Resilience: Founded in the aftermath of 9/11, Voices Center for Resilience, (formerly Voices of September 11th) provides long-term support and access to mental health care and resources for thousands of victims’ families, responders and survivors. VOICES collaborates with partners to assist communities in preparing for, responding to and recovering from tragedies, in the United States and abroad. With an emphasis on providing support, education and training, VOICES comprehensive approach underscores a commitment to promote resilience in the lives of those impacted and build bridges between communities affected by tragedy.
